Required Fields — Yuma Utility Trailer Bill of Sale
All of the following must appear on a valid utility trailer bill of sale in Yuma, Arizona:
- ✓Full legal name and current address of seller
- ✓Full legal name and current address of buyer
- ✓Agreed sale price (in numerals and words)
- ✓Date of sale
- ✓Utility Trailer year, make, model, and body style
- ✓17-character VIN (Vehicle Identification Number)
- ✓Signature of seller
- ✓Signature of buyer
Notarization in Yuma: Not Required
Arizona does not require notarization for a utility trailer bill of sale. Arizona does not require notarization for a vehicle bill of sale. Buyer and seller signatures on the title and a written bill of sale are sufficient. Both parties simply sign and date the completed form in the presence of each other.

Additional requirements in Yuma County:
- Complete an AZ MVD title application (Form 96-0236) within 15 days of sale
- Seller must complete the assignment on the back of the Arizona title
- Use tax (5.6%) paid by buyer at time of title transfer
- Odometer disclosure required for vehicles under 10 years old
What to Bring to the AZ DMV
- 1Completed, signed utility trailer bill of sale
- 2Utility Trailer title signed over by seller on the back
- 3Valid government-issued photo ID (driver's license or passport)
- 4Payment for title transfer fee: $4.00
- 5Payment for sales tax (9.20% of sale price)

- What is the title transfer fee for a utility trailer in Yuma?
- The title transfer fee in Yuma County is $4.00. The utility trailer sales tax rate is 9.20%. Arizona state rate 5.6% + Yuma County 1.1% + Yuma city rate 2.5%
